I was at Sam's Club in Orange, CT on Saturday and saw the Seville Classics UltraHD 12-Drawer Rolling Workbench on clearance for $199.91. The price on this item still shows up as $429.99 on their website [samsclub.com], so BM only, and YMMV.

They only had one, I bought it. Not sure if this deal is reproducible, since, just like Target and Lowes clearance, each Sam's Club seems to have its own (sometimes discretionary) clearance items.


Dimensions are 72" W x 20" D x 37" H, but I don't think this length includes the handles. It comes disassembled, flat-packed in two large heavy boxes. While assembly is relatively easy, it is a lot of work and time-consuming (at least a few hours assembly time). You have to assemble each drawer individually [youtube.com], and you should definitely follow the assembly manual, some things are much easier when the steps are done in the correct order.
